FEATURES

  • Precision hole grid

    Ø5 mm holes spaced 10 mm apart, with each row offset by 5 mm, create consistent reference points across the entire bed.

  • Modular FIXTURES and CAM LOCKS

    Secure flat, thin, tall, round, or irregular objects without custom bed-sized jigs.

  • High-grade silicone MATS

    Flexible, durable, and resistant to UV overspray—designed to last the life of the machine.

  • Built-in repeatability

    Once a setup works, it stays working. Print, remove the part, drop in a new blank, and print again.This is how industrial workflows feel—translated to a desktop machine.

SETUP & INSTALLATION

  • Remove your printer bed from the machine.
  • Leave or remove the original sticky mat (your choice)
  • Place the ULTIM8™ JIG MAT on top and align it
  • Secure using the SPRING CLIPS

  • Arrange FIXTURES as needed to position your parts
  • Use FIXTURES alone or combined with CAM LOCKS

Height Guidelines:

  • Ensure parts sit no more than 2 mm below the highest fixture point
  • Parts ≥ 1.5 mm → use 2.4 FIXTURES
  • Parts > 4 mm → use 5.0 FIXTURES
  • Parts < 1.5 mm → use BACKING PLATES + MAGNETS

CLEANING & USE

Overspray removes easily:

  • Fingernail peel
  • Flex the MAT
  • Or use packing tape

CALIBRATION

No recalibration required.

  • Calibrate normally without the MAT
  • Optional: run calibration on top using a CALIBRATION SHEET

For Zero Point Calibration:
